To ask for a court hearing to change your existing custody and visitation order:

  • Fill out your court forms. Fill out the Request for Order ( Form FL-300 ). You can use the Information Sheet for Request for Order ( Form FL-300-INFO) ...
  • Have your forms reviewed. If your court’s family law facilitator helps people with custody and visitation cases, ask them to review your paperwork.
  • Make at least 2 copies of all your forms. One copy will be for you; another copy will be for your child’s other parent. The original is for the court.

To put it simply, yes, parents can potentially modify their custody arrangement without going to court in California. If the parties can agree upon the child custody and visitation modifications, they are free to enter into a stipulation which is then signed by a family court judge.Nov 12, 2020
